The wheel of fortune tarot card meaningis one of the deck's most symbolic cards, featuring a plethora of symbols, each with its significance.
Wheel of fortune tarot cardmeaning indicates esoteric symbols sit in the card's center. The angel, the eagle, the bull, and the lion are among the creatures that circle the wheel.
They are associated with the zodiac signsof Leo, Taurus, Scorpio, and Aquarius.
In Christian beliefs, these four animals are also symbolic of the four evangelists, which may explain why they are all decorated with wings.
The Torah, which imparts wisdom and self-understanding, is represented by the books that each of the creatures holds.
The snake represents the descent into the material world.
A sphinx sits at the top of the wheel, with what looks to be either a demon or Anubis himself emerging from the bottom.
These two Egyptian statues signify both the gods' and monarchs' knowledge (in the case of the sphinx) as well as the underworld (Anubis).
They spin in a circle indefinitely, implying that as one rises, the other falls. The Wheel of Fortune card depicts a massive wheel with three characters on its rims.
The unpronounceable name of God, YHVH (Yod Heh Vau Heh), is engraved on the wheel's face in four Hebrew characters.
There are also the letters TORA, which are supposed to be a misspelling of Torah, which means' law, 'or TAROT, or even ROTA (Latin for' wheel. ')
The alchemical symbols for mercury, sulfur, water, and salt, the building blocks of life and the four elements, are represented in the middle wheel, which denotes formative force.
A serpent, the Egyptian deity Typhon (the god of evil), descends on the left side of the outer circle.
The life energy diving into the material world is likewise symbolized by the snake.
The Egyptian God of the Dead, Anubis, emerges on the right side, welcoming souls to the underworld. The Sphinx, who represents knowledge and might, sits atop the wheel.
The four-winged creatures on the Wheel of Fortune card's corners represent the four fixed signs of the Zodiac: the angel represents Aquarius, the eagle represents Scorpio, the lion represents Leo, and the bull represents Taurus.
Their wings indicate stability in the face of change, and each bears the Torah, which represents knowledge.

Wheel Of Fortune Tarot Card Meaning Reversed

Wheel of fortune tarot card meaning, reversal of a card implies that your fortune and fate may be deteriorating.
Your circumstances may soon go from good to worse. Something unexpected may occur, or negative forces may be at work, rendering you helpless.
You can either donothing and trust that things will get better on their own, or you can take steps to improve things.
Make the most of your opportunity to reclaim control of your life.
Accepting responsibility for your current situation is the first step in altering your fate and destiny.
Consider how your previous actions have influenced your current circumstance.
If you think everything is out of your hands, you might be shocked to realize that there is always something you can do to make things better.
What lessons can you learn from this event to help you avoid making the same mistakes again in the future?
The Reversed Wheel of Fortune card also represents your reluctance to change and development, particularly if it is pushed upon you.
This card indicates that you've become quite concerned about the rate of change and are trying everything you can to slow it down.
You are both consciously and subconsciously reluctant to change.
You'll have a far better experience if you can accept that change is unavoidable.
The reversal of the Wheel of Fortune might indicate that you have finally ended a negative spiral or vicious cycle in your life.
Perhaps you've accepted that your efforts have resulted in a repeated pattern, and you're now ready to break the cycle.
This may come naturally to certain people after a time of self-discovery and contemplation.
For other people, things may have to go much worse and reach rock bottom before they understand what isn't working.
This is especially true if the Devil or The Tower appears in your tarot reading.

Wheel Of Fortune Tarot Card Meaning Love

If you're in a relationship, an upright Wheel of Fortune usually denotes a good shift, so you may be taking the next step in your relationship, embarking on a new period with your spouse, or even embarking on a joint endeavor.
At the same time, the Wheel of Fortune Tarot card's transition may be challenging.
This card might indicate an upheaval if you have been discovering that you are no longer satisfied in a partnership.
That may mean you and your spouse shaking things up and making much-needed adjustments to strengthen your relationship, or it could mean a breakup that frees you to pursue other opportunities.
Whatever occurs, it will take you to your intended destination.
If you're single, the wheel of fortune tarot card meaning in your Tarot reading might imply that the cosmos is striving to bring you the love you deserve, but you must cooperate!
You've had fantastic luckwith love, so now is the time to put yourself out there and meet new people.
If this card appears in your Tarot deck, make sure you're clear on what you want in a mate since you'll have a chance to acquire it if you're careful.
Because the Wheel of Fortune is also a card of fate, it might represent soulmates in a romantic situation.
If you're single, you could meet your match soon. If you're in a relationship, it may suggest that you and your partner were made for each other!
Confirm this using the supported cards.
If you're in a relationship, the Wheel of Fortune reversed might suggest stagnation or the flame fading from the partnership.
That isn't to say that you should leave the relationship on the spur of the moment; all partnerships have their ups and downs.
You may be just transitioning from one stage of a relationship to the next, and this is merely a lull in the process.
Try to evaluate the issue and figure out what works best for you.
In any case, this period of turbulence will pass. Previous errors may resurface and cause problems.
If you're single and have had a string of bad luck in relationships, you should examine your own choices and behavior.
Have you squandered opportunities to fall in love? If that's the case, learn from your errors and you'll get a second opportunity at happiness.
We pick the lessons we are intended to learn in this life, and by learning from your past and applying these karmic lessons to your future, you may change your luck.
The Wheel of Fortune The Tarot card in reversed position indicates that you may face obstacles or delays, whether you are single or in a relationship. The only way up is to go with the flow.
